0

OK ここで、私と私の友人が適切なプログラミング ソリューションについて議論しているハードコアな質問があります。

たとえば、UTC-4 の時点で私がニューヨークで事業を営んでいるとします。

2013 年 12 月 31 日の午後 11 時 (私の時間では 2014 年 1 月 1 日の午前 1 時) に、サンフランシスコに拠点を置く私の営業担当者は、会社に 1,000,000 米ドルの純利益をもたらす販売を行います。彼は 2013 年 12 月 31 日にシステムにセールを入力しますが、実際には、私の時間では 2014 年 1 月 1 日に発生します。

2013 年のレポートでは、$1,000,000 USD を利益として含めるべきですか、それとも 2014 年のレポートに含めるのでしょうか?

問題を解決するための関連する質問...ほとんどの企業は、12 月 31 日の 1 日あたりの売り上げをどのように計算していますか? 会社の本社タイムゾーンの午前 0 時から最後の 24 時間ですか、それとも市場の各タイムゾーンを集計した 12 月 31 日ですか?

さらに、販売のために日付 (YYYY-MM-DD) しか入力されていない場合、UTC の日が 2 つの固有の日付にまたがっているため、どのように変換して UTC に保存する必要がありますか?

この質問を分析するために使用した便利なツールを次に示します。

http://everytimezone.com/#2013-8-27,-420,6bj

4

1 に答える 1